It looks like it is a salvage car bought at an auction or something like that. The OP says it was registered in California at one time. The problem is that California will not release any information on anybody or any vehicle at any time. It used to be (years ago) that you could go to the DMV with a license plate number and they would give you the address of the owner. They quit that many years ago. I am sure that there might be a way still. Maybe give the DMV your contact information and see if they will pass that on to the last owner by mail or something like that. I doubt it though. |
Quote:
And the state ( ca) where it was vin'ed.. shows the last record with them was 1988. Not sure how else to get that info? |
you will need your local police to have what is called "a hand search" done to the record. nothing going back to 1988 is in the electronic data base once a car is not registered for a certain period its info is purged.
i just did this on a CA car myself. be forewarned the info may not be that comprehensive. likely will not tell you manufacturer, just owner and dates of registration if it is even found. |
